Does the Verb tense disagree in My dog jumped up and down when I open the door

Respuesta :

dinchi94
dinchi94 dinchi94
  • 25-05-2020

Answer:

Yes, it does.

Explanation:

Yes, the verb tense disagrees. In one half of the sentence (My dog jumped up and down) the tense is past tense, whereas in the second half of the sentence (when I open the door) is in present tense.
